A visualized parallel network simulator for modeling large-scale distributed applications

被引:0
|
作者
Lin, Siming [1 ]
Cheng, Xueqi [1 ]
Lv, Jianming [1 ]
机构
[1] Chinese Acad Sci, Inst Comp Technol, Beijing, Peoples R China
关键词
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Large-scale distributed systems, with thousands or even millions of nodes, produce complex and dynamic behaviors. Packet-level simulation is necessary to test and analyze these systems, such as grids, peer-to-peer (P2P) applications as well as worm and DDoS containment systems. However, the current network simulators are not convenient for application layer simulation. We present the NSME, a visualized parallel simulator that allows researchers to simulate their applications in a large virtual network with most details transparent to them. A hierarchical routing is used to enhance the fidelity of simulation and reduce the memory cost of network construction. A variation of CAM algorithm is implemented for parallel synchronization. We show the functions of NSME by three applications: 1) a self-similar background traffic model, 2) a Slammer worm spreading model, and 3) a P2P live streaming system, which demonstrate its effectiveness for simulating any large-scale distributed applications. The performance tests show that the memory cost of NSME is distinctly lower than NS2 and the parallel efficiency can reach about 60% in any of the above applications.
引用
收藏
页码:339 / 346
页数:8
相关论文
共 50 条
  • [31] A Workflow for Parallel and Distributed Computing of Large-Scale Genomic Data
    Choi, Hyun-Hwa
    Kim, Byoung-Seob
    Ahn, Shin-Young
    Bae, Seung-Jo
    2013 8TH INTERNATIONAL CONFERENCE FOR INTERNET TECHNOLOGY AND SECURED TRANSACTIONS (ICITST), 2013, : 215 - 218
  • [32] An autonomic operating environment for large-scale distributed applications
    Lehman, TJ
    Deen, RG
    Kaufman, JH
    INTEGRATED COMPUTER-AIDED ENGINEERING, 2006, 13 (01) : 81 - 99
  • [33] Large-scale parallel reservoir simulation on distributed memory systems
    Cao, JW
    Pan, F
    Sun, JC
    Liu, W
    DCABES 2001 PROCEEDINGS, 2001, : 98 - 103
  • [34] Genesis: A system for large-scale parallel network simulation
    Szymanski, BK
    Saifee, A
    Sastry, A
    Liu, Y
    Madnani, K
    16TH WORKSHOP ON PARALLEL AND DISTRIBUTED SIMULATION, PROCEEDINGS, 2002, : 89 - 96
  • [35] Large-Scale Parallel Matching of Social Network Profiles
    Panchenko, Alexander
    Babaev, Dmitry
    Obiedkov, Sergei
    ANALYSIS OF IMAGES, SOCIAL NETWORKS AND TEXTS, AIST 2015, 2015, 542 : 275 - 285
  • [36] Incremental modeling under large-scale distributed interaction
    Wedde, HF
    Wedig, A
    Lazarescu, A
    Paaschen, R
    Rotaru, E
    FORMAL TECHNIQUES FOR NETWORKED AND DISTRIBUTED SYSTEMS - FORTE 2005, 2005, 3731 : 542 - 546
  • [37] Large-Scale Subspace Clustering by Independent Distributed and Parallel Coding
    Li, Jun
    Tao, Zhiqiang
    Wu, Yue
    Zhong, Bineng
    Fu, Yun
    IEEE TRANSACTIONS ON CYBERNETICS, 2022, 52 (09) : 9090 - 9100
  • [38] Towards a common infrastructure for large-scale distributed applications
    Nikolaou, C
    Marazakis, M
    Papadakis, D
    Yeorgiannakis, Y
    Sairamesh, J
    RESEARCH AND ADVANCED TECHNOLOGY FOR DIGITAL LIBRARIES, 1997, 1324 : 173 - 193
  • [39] TRACES GENERATION TO SIMULATE LARGE-SCALE DISTRIBUTED APPLICATIONS
    Dalle, Olivier
    Mancini, Emilio P.
    PROCEEDINGS OF THE 2011 WINTER SIMULATION CONFERENCE (WSC), 2011, : 2993 - 3001
  • [40] Network placement optimization for large-scale distributed system
    Ren, Yu
    Liu, Fangfang
    Fu, Yunxia
    Zhou, Zheng
    2017 INTERNATIONAL CONFERENCE ON OPTICAL INSTRUMENTS AND TECHNOLOGY - OPTOELECTRONIC MEASUREMENT TECHNOLOGY AND SYSTEMS, 2017, 10621